Meaning of “aeronautical services and facilities”
Subregulation 1
In these Rules, “aeronautical services and facilities”, in relation to an airport licensee for an airport, means all or any of the following services or facilities provided by the airport licensee for that airport:
those services and facilities provided at the airport that are essential to the operation and maintenance of civil aviation at the airport, and includes each service or facility that is —
mentioned in an item in Part I of the First Schedule (aircraft-related); or
mentioned in an item in Part II of the First Schedule (passenger-related and cargo‑related);
such other services and facilities provided at the airport which the Authority certifies under rule 5 as a service that the airport licensee has the market power of a monopoly or near monopoly in Singapore as a provider of such service.
Subregulation 2
For the avoidance of doubt, aeronautical services and facilities do not include air navigation services and unregulated services and facilities.
